What is Bluetooth?
Bluetooth is a standard for short-range wireless technology intended to connect devices without wires. It allows for wireless communication between devices like smartphones, tablets, headphones, and computers. Bluetooth operates over short distances, typically up to 100 meters, depending on the class of the device.

- For Windows: Go to Settings > Devices > Bluetooth & other devices, and turn on Bluetooth.
- For macOS: Go to System Preferences > Bluetooth, and switch it on.
-
For mobile devices: Access Settings > Bluetooth and toggle it on.
